Responsibilities

  • Conduct keyword research to identify content opportunities for clients
  • Write comprehensive articles on a variety of topics with minimal supervision
  • Demonstrate the ability to adapt tone and complexity of a piece to speak to the correct audience, as well as align with relevant style guides
  • Demonstrate the ability to implement feedback from editors, clients, and teammates
  • Demonstrate understanding of the project lifecycle and ability to collaborate across departments 
  • Have a firm grasp on writing effective titles for improved CTR and for the press
  • Hit client SEO traffic goals month over month by creating content that ranks and/or generates passive links
  • Deliver a reliable, solutions-oriented approach to growing the online presence of our clients 

Required Skills

  • 1–2 years as a content marketer (ideally published on reputable news sites or industry blogs)
  • A working knowledge of SEO tools and how they can be used to improve client websites
  • Goal-orientated with the ability to set priorities, meet deadlines, and work independently
  •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to form productive working relationships in a remote environment
  • Strong project management skills, with ability to handle multiple projects while still working effectively
  • Close attention to detail and a heavy focus on creating quality content
  • Proven ability to generate creative ideas that attract attention on the web

Suggested Skills

  • 2–4 years experience working in an agency or similar marketing environment
  • B.A. or similar degree in English, journalism, or similar field
  • Experience using Google Workspace, Smartsheet, Zoom, and/or Basecamp
  • Understanding of HTML/CSS and comfortable uploading content to WordPress and other similar Content Management Systems
  • Experience collaborating with design teams and giving guidance on design and UX best practices

The salary range for this position is $52,000.00–$64,000.00 DOE. This position is 100% remote and based in the United States.
